Technical Skills Every Application Developer Must Have
Proficiency in Programming Languages
When it comes to hiring an application developer, think of programming languages like a chef’s ingredients. Without mastery of the right languages, even the most beautiful UI designs or clever ideas won’t materialize.
So, which languages matter most? It depends on your project, but here are the staples:
- Java: The backbone of Android development and a staple in enterprise systems.
- Python: Loved for its simplicity and used in everything from AI to web development.
- Swift: The go-to language for iOS development, powering millions of Apple apps.
- JavaScript: Essential for web apps, especially with frameworks like React or Angular.
- Kotlin: A modern alternative to Java for Android apps.
- C#: Particularly relevant for Windows applications and Unity-based games.
It’s not enough to just know these languages. Your ideal candidate should be proficient—meaning they can build, debug, refactor, and optimize code with ease. They should also understand coding conventions, write clean, maintainable code, and keep up with language updates.
Some developers specialize deeply in one or two languages; others are polyglots who love learning new ones. Depending on your needs, either can be valuable—as long as they demonstrate a deep understanding of their chosen stack.
Understanding of Front-End and Back-End Development
Front-end development is the face of your application—the part users interact with. Back-end development is the engine under the hood—the database, servers, and application logic that make things work.
Hiring an app developer who understands both (often called a full-stack developer) can be a game-changer, especially for small teams or startups. Full-stack developers can quickly transition from designing user interfaces to writing server-side logic, reducing communication gaps and speeding up development cycles.
Front-End Essentials:
- HTML, CSS, and JavaScript
- Frameworks like React, Angular, or Vue.js
- Responsive design principles
- Accessibility and performance optimization
Back-End Essentials:
- Server-side languages like Node.js, Python (Django/Flask), Ruby, PHP
- Database management with SQL (PostgreSQL, MySQL) or NoSQL (MongoDB, Firebase)
- API development (RESTful or GraphQL)
- Authentication, security practices, and data validation
Even if you’re hiring for a single specific role—like Android development—it’s beneficial if your developer understands how their code fits into the larger system. This leads to better architecture decisions and more scalable applications.
Expertise in Frameworks and Tools
Popular Frameworks like React, Angular, and Flutter
When you’re hiring an application developer, you’re not just hiring someone who writes code—you’re hiring someone who builds experiences. And the frameworks they know often shape the kind of experiences they can create.
Frameworks are essentially pre-built sets of code, tools, and best practices that speed up the development process and ensure applications are efficient and scalable. Think of frameworks as the blueprint that lets a builder construct a sturdy house faster.
Here’s a quick guide to some of the most in-demand frameworks:
- React (JavaScript): Dominates the web development scene. Known for building fast, interactive UIs. Created by Facebook.
- Angular (TypeScript): Popular for complex enterprise-level applications. Backed by Google.
- Vue.js (JavaScript): Lightweight, flexible, and gaining popularity for building reactive web interfaces.
- Flutter (Dart): Google’s open-source framework for creating beautiful, natively compiled mobile, web, and desktop applications from a single codebase.
- React Native (JavaScript): Ideal for building mobile apps for both iOS and Android with shared code.
Knowing these frameworks helps developers build more efficiently. Plus, they come with large communities, tons of support, and frequent updates—meaning your project won’t be stuck using outdated tech.
For example, if you’re planning a cross-platform mobile app that works on both iOS and Android, a developer proficient in Flutter or React Native could save you both time and budget by using a single codebase.
Version Control Tools (Git, GitHub, Bitbucket)
Let’s be honest: development is messy. Features break. Experiments fail. Deadlines creep up. That’s why developers must be fluent in version control systems.
Version control is like a time machine for your code—it tracks changes, lets developers experiment safely, and ensures the whole team can work on the same project without stepping on each other’s toes.
Popular tools include:
- Git: The industry standard for version control.
- GitHub: The most popular platform for hosting and collaborating on Git repositories.
- Bitbucket: Often preferred for private repositories and integrations with Jira.
- GitLab: A powerful DevOps platform combining source control with CI/CD pipelines.
If your developer can’t confidently use Git, that’s a red flag. Version control isn’t just a “nice-to-have”—it’s essential. Look for developers who understand branching strategies, pull requests, merge conflicts, and CI/CD pipelines. These practices make teamwork seamless and projects far more resilient.

Database Management Skills
SQL and NoSQL Databases
Every great application needs a solid database behind it. Data is the lifeblood of most apps—whether it’s storing user accounts, order histories, or financial transactions.
Good developers don’t just connect to a database; they design databases thoughtfully, ensuring they’re secure, fast, and scalable. There are two broad categories you should know:
- SQL Databases (Relational):
- Examples: MySQL, PostgreSQL, Microsoft SQL Server
- Ideal for structured data with clear relationships (e.g., customer orders, financial records)
- NoSQL Databases (Non-relational):
- Examples: MongoDB, Firebase, CouchDB
- Best for flexible, rapidly changing data (e.g., social media content, app activity logs)
Your ideal developer should know when to use each type and how to optimize queries for performance.
A practical example? Imagine a food delivery app. User profiles might be stored in an SQL database, but real-time location tracking could benefit from a NoSQL approach for speed and flexibility.
Data Security Best Practices
Data breaches aren’t just embarrassing—they’re business killers. Your developer must take data security seriously.
What should they know?
- How to store passwords securely (hint: never in plain text!).
- Using encryption for sensitive information.
- Securing API endpoints from unauthorized access.
- Following compliance regulations (GDPR, HIPAA, depending on your industry).
A developer who understands security from the start prevents nasty surprises down the road. It’s always better to build security into the app, not bolt it on later.
Problem‑Solving and Analytical Thinking
Debugging and Testing Skills
A developer’s ability to debug systematically is the hallmark of strong analytical thinking. Look for candidates who can trace problems, isolate causes, and understand why something fails—not just slap on a quick fix. In interviews, ask them to explain debugging tactics:
- Do they use browser dev tools, log analysis, and stack traces?
- Can they walk through a complex bug and explain step-by-step how they’d locate and resolve it?
- Do they write unit tests, integration tests, or automated UI tests?
Developers who prioritize test-driven development (TDD) or who consistently include test cases show strong forethought. Experienced developers write code with testing in mind—modular, loosely coupled components that are easier to test. They should be comfortable with testing frameworks like JUnit, pytest, Jest, or Cypress.
A red flag is when a developer avoids writing tests or says they “don’t have time.” Testing isn’t optional—it’s a safeguard against regressions and system failures. Someone confident in their debugging and testing skills will make your codebase more robust and maintainable over time.
Handling Real-Time Errors and Failures
No matter how well-built your app is, errors—especially in real-time—will happen. The key is how the developer responds and recovers. Developers should understand how to implement error-handling patterns:
- Graceful degradation: presenting user-friendly messages instead of exposing raw error codes.
- Retry mechanisms, circuit breakers, and fallback strategies for intermittent failures.
- Logging and monitoring: setting up alerts with tools like Sentry, New Relic, or Logstash to catch issues before users do.
- Chaos engineering: deliberately testing how the app handles failures (e.g., killing services, injecting latency).
More importantly, the right developer should approach errors as opportunities to improve system resilience. Ask candidates to describe a time when they turned a production failure into a long-term solution. Those stories reveal a mindset focused on stability and continuous improvement.

Agile and Scrum Methodologies
Modern development is iterative: agile and scrum are industry standards. When interviewing, assess whether the developer:
- Can articulate the values of agile—responding to change, delivering small increments, and emphasizing customer collaboration.
- Has experience in sprints, standups, retrospectives, and backlog grooming.
- Understands roles: developer, scrum master, product owner.
- Contributes to sprint planning and commits to delivering what’s promised.
Developers aligned with agile principles will be more flexible, accountable, and proactive in structured team environments.

Security Awareness and Ethical Practices
Understanding of Secure Coding Standards
Security is everyone’s job. Qualified developers should:
- Avoid injection vulnerabilities (SQL, command).
- Understand OWASP Top 10.
- Validate inputs both client- and server-side.
- Use HTTPS, SSL/TLS.
- Protect against CSRF, XSS, and other exploits.
Ask developers to walk through security considerations they took in past projects. Secure coding isn’t optional—it’s mandatory.
Privacy Regulations and Compliance
Many apps handle sensitive data—personal info, health records, financials—that require regulatory compliance:
- GDPR (EU), CCPA (California), HIPAA (healthcare), PCI DSS (payments).
- Enforcing data encryption at rest and in transit.
- Implementing user consent, data retention policies, and right-to-be-forgotten workflows.
Developers experienced with privacy laws are a major asset. Even basic knowledge about consent or compliance is better than none.
